C#でZIPを作成する

この簡単なチュートリアルでは、C#でZIPファイルを作成する方法を説明します。アルゴリズムやコードスニペットを含め、C#のZIPファイル作成ツールの開発方法を詳しく紹介します。さらに、.NETフレームワークがインストールされている環境であれば、どのOSでも使用できます。

C#でZIPを作成する手順

  1. ZIPアーカイブを作成するためにNuGetパッケージマネージャーでAspose.ZIPを設定する。
  2. 出力ZIPアーカイブを保存するためにFileStreamクラスのオブジェクトを作成する。
  3. ZIPアーカイブに追加するソースファイルを開く。
  4. CreateEntryメソッドを使用してロードしたファイルをZIPディレクトリに追加する。
  5. Saveメソッドを呼び出して生成したZIPファイルを書き出す。

これらの手順は、C#でZIPを作成する方法を示しています。設定の詳細を説明し、その後、C#のコードスニペットを提供してこの機能を活用する方法を紹介します。出力ファイルストリームを作成し、ZIPアーカイブにファイルを追加し、最終的に保存するという流れです。

C#でZIPファイルを作成するコード

このコードスニペットは、C#でZIPファイルを作成する方法を示しています。さらに、CreateEntryメソッドを何度も呼び出して、複数のファイルをZIPに追加することができます。また、SelfExtractingOptions、Encryption、ParallelOptionsなどのArchiveSaveOptionsクラスのプロパティをカスタマイズすることも可能です。

このチュートリアルでは、C#のZIPメーカーの作成方法を詳しく説明しました。CSVファイルを圧縮する方法については、C#でCSVを圧縮するの記事をご覧ください。

 日本語